> "Additionally, you can't have more than one NewDialog control event
> on a button, even if the conditions are mutually exclusive." - this is
> interesting. Ca n you tell me where this fact comes from?

Found it.

Its in the docs for the ControlEvent table.

<http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/aa368037(VS.85).aspx>

    "The exception is that each control can publish a most one
    NewDialog or one SpawnDialog event."
